An independent insurance agent in Las Vegas works differently than someone tied to a single insurance company. Instead of offering products from just one brand, these local professionals partner with multiple top-rated carriers. This allows them to shop the market on your behalf, comparing various policies and prices to find coverage that truly fits your unique needs.
Unlike anonymous 800-numbers or single-brand storefronts, an independent agent provides personalized, unbiased advice. They understand the specific risks and opportunities that come with living in Las Vegas, from navigating health plan marketplaces to securing your family's financial future. For seniors in Las Vegas, Medicare coverage is a significant area of focus. Nevada residents approaching or enrolled in Medicare can choose between different pathways, including Original Medicare, Medicare Advantage plans, or adding a Medicare Supplement (Medigap) plan and a stand-alone Part D prescription drug plan. Each option has distinct features regarding costs, benefits, and provider networks.

When exploring life insurance in Las Vegas, you'll generally encounter two main types: term life and permanent life. Term life provides coverage for a specific period, often at a lower initial cost, making it suitable for covering specific financial obligations like a mortgage or children's education. Permanent life, such as whole life or universal life, offers lifelong coverage and often includes a cash value component that can grow over time.
Annuities are another important tool for long-term financial planning, particularly for retirement income in Las Vegas. These financial products can provide a steady stream of income later in life, offering different options like fixed, variable, or indexed annuities, each with varying levels of risk and potential return. They can be a valuable complement to other retirement savings.

Navigating Medicare options in Las Vegas involves understanding Medicare Advantage plans (Part C), Medicare Supplement plans (Medigap), and Medicare Part D prescription drug plans. Medicare Advantage plans are offered by private companies and often bundle hospital, medical, and prescription drug coverage into one plan, sometimes including extra benefits. Medicare Supplement plans work alongside Original Medicare to help cover costs like deductibles and co-insurance, while Part D plans provide prescription drug coverage.

Local resources to know
When seeking insurance in Las Vegas, it's wise to be aware of local and state resources that can provide valuable information and support. The Nevada Division of Insurance is a key regulatory body that oversees the insurance industry in the state. They offer consumer information, handle complaints, and ensure that insurance companies and agents comply with state laws.
For those exploring Medicare options in Las Vegas, the State Health Insurance Assistance Program (SHIP) of Nevada offers free, unbiased counseling. This program provides personalized guidance on Medicare plans, benefits, and how to navigate enrollment periods, helping you make informed decisions about your healthcare coverage.
